The Rules Committee recommended Angeles Roy to fill a vacant seat on the Immigrant Rights Commission for a term ending June 6, 2018, after Roy described her immigrant-rights work and civic leadership; the committee approved the nomination without objection and forwarded it to the full Board.

The San Francisco Board of Supervisors Rules Committee on March 22 recommended Angeles Roy to fill a vacant seat on the city’s Immigrant Rights Commission.

Supervisor Asha Safaei, chair of the Rules Committee, called Roy’s application qualified and the committee approved the recommendation "without objection," sending the nomination forward for Board consideration. The seat carries a term ending June 6, 2018.
